31 lines
852 B
Bash
31 lines
852 B
Bash
#!/bin/bash
|
|
|
|
mkdir /data/graylog-mongodb/configdb
|
|
mkdir /data/graylog-mongodb/db
|
|
chmod 777 /data/graylog-mongodb/configdb
|
|
chmod 777 /data/graylog-mongodb/db
|
|
|
|
if [ ! -f /data/.env ]
|
|
then
|
|
cp /data/env_example /data/.env
|
|
fi
|
|
|
|
if [ ! -f /data/opensearch-node1/config/internal_users.yml ]
|
|
then
|
|
cp /data/opensearch-node1/config/internal_users_example.yml /data/opensearch-node1/config/internal_users.yml
|
|
mkdir /data/opensearch-node2/config/
|
|
cp /data/opensearch-node1/config/internal_users_example.yml /data/opensearch-node2/config/internal_users.yml
|
|
fi
|
|
|
|
if [ ! -d "/data/opensearch-node1/data/" ]
|
|
then
|
|
echo "creating opensearch node1 data directoy"
|
|
mkdir -p /data/opensearch-node1/data/
|
|
fi
|
|
|
|
if [ ! -d "/data/opensearch-node2/data/" ]
|
|
then
|
|
echo "creating opensearch node2 data directoy"
|
|
mkdir -p /data/opensearch-node2/data/
|
|
fi
|